Sant Joanet (Catalan pronunciation:[ˈsaɲdʒuaˈnet],Spanish:San Juan de Énova), formerly known asSant Joan de l'Ènova is amunicipality in thecomarca ofRibera Alta in theValencian Community, Spain.
